Course Overview
This intermediate-level continuing education course provides therapists with essential knowledge for evaluating and implementing appropriate wheelchair seating interventions. The course takes a systematic approach to positioning challenges, exploring common issues and solutions by body area. Beginning with the pelvis as the foundation of seating, participants learn how pelvic position directly impacts trunk alignment, head position, and overall function. Through detailed examination of positioning challenges for the trunk, lower extremities, upper extremities, and head, therapists gain practical skills in assessment and intervention selection.
